Output 2f6f7ec971987bb3002ba2c14cfc366a3b4a7fb811751a319922ff3a236f9284:0

value
68840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a91d675b84242c4e239d938d02338a9f80684359 OP_EQUAL
address
3H7DLyFxBzLuSquU91RYTaHxojRJ3vAB7S
transaction
2f6f7ec971987bb3002ba2c14cfc366a3b4a7fb811751a319922ff3a236f9284
confirmations
136491
spent
true